| Error Message | Cause | Solution |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| | Mismatched partition table or wrong CSC file. | Re-download the correct firmware from GSMROMMET for your exact model number. Use the correct PIT file (rarely needed). | | "SW REV. CHECK FAIL. Device: X, Binary: Y" | You are trying to downgrade to an older bootloader version. Samsung prevents this. | You can only flash firmware with a bootloader version equal to or higher than the current one. Check the 5th digit from the end in the PDA version. | | "Complete(Write) operation failed." | USB connection interruption or bad cable. | Use a different USB port (preferably USB 2.0 on the back of the PC). Change the cable. Reinstall Samsung USB drivers. | | Odin freezes at "SetupConnection" | Driver conflict or the phone exited Download Mode. | Disconnect, force restart the phone back into Download Mode, and run Odin as Administrator. | | Phone shows "Only official released binaries are allowed" | Knox counter tripped or custom binary detected. | Flash the exact official firmware from GSMROMMET that matches your original region. |
